NPCollege vs. Healthcare Career
Both National Polytechnic College and Healthcare Career College are Private, 2-4 years schools located in California. The following statements compare National Polytechnic College and Healthcare Career College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- NPCollege's tuition ($42,520) is more expensive than Healthcare Career ($16,260).
- Healthcare Career's students to faculty ratio (10 to 1) is lower than NPCollege (20 to 1).
- NPCollege (516 students) is larger than Healthcare Career (447 students) with more enrolled students.
- NPCollege ($6,225) has higher amount of financial aid than Healthcare Career ($5,845).
- Healthcare Career's graduation rate (71%) is higher than NPCollege (47%).
